Ethical considerations play a crucial role in determining the choices individuals make in various aspects of life. However, ethical dilemmas often arise when striking a balance between personal interests and societal obligations. Navigating this fine line requires a conscious evaluation of the potential consequences of our decisions. Let us delve deeper into this ethical issue by examining decision-making processes and the importance of ethical values.

Decision-making is central to resolving ethical dilemmas. When faced with conflicting interests, it is essential to consider the impact of our choices on ourselves and others. Whether it is deciding between personal gain and environmental sustainability or career advancement and fairness, ethical dilemmas challenge our values and principles. Making informed decisions involves thoughtful analysis of the potential short-term and long-term effects on society and the well-being of others.

Ethical values serve as guiding principles to navigate the complex terrain of moral dilemmas. Honesty, fairness, and compassion are foundational to ethical decision-making. These values often call upon us to sacrifice personal benefits in favor of contributing to the greater good—a recognition that fulfilling our social responsibility is not mutually exclusive from personal growth and achievement. Moreover, ethical values encourage us to develop empathy, embracing the perspective of others affected by our choices.

It is important to acknowledge that ethical dilemmas can be subjective and context-dependent. What may seem ethically justifiable to one individual might be perceived as questionable by another. As a society, we must strive to foster open discussions and encourage critical thinking when faced with such dilemmas, recognizing that ethical dilemmas are not always black and white.

In conclusion, the ethical dilemma of balancing personal and social responsibility is a significant challenge in our lives. Decision-making processes and ethical values play a pivotal role in resolving these dilemmas. By considering the consequences of our choices and embracing ethical principles, we can strive to make decisions that align personal fulfillment with social welfare.
